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ide comprehensive primary care services, including routine check-ups, health screenings, and preventive care.
  • Diagnose and manage acute and chronic medical conditions such as hypertension, diabetes, respiratory infections, and other common illnesses.
  • Order, interpret, and analyze diagnostic tests and laboratory results.
  • Prescribe medications and develop individualized treatment plans.
  • Educate patients and families on disease prevention, lifestyle modifications, and treatment options.
  • Coordinate care with specialists and other healthcare professionals within the multi-specialty practice.
  • Maintain accurate, thorough, and timely documentation in electronic medical records.
  • Provide compassionate and patient-centered care to a diverse patient population.
